+#include <assert.h>
+#include <intelblocks/gpio.h>
+#include <intelblocks/pcr.h>
+#include <soc/pcr_ids.h>
+#include <soc/pm.h>
+
+static const struct reset_mapping rst_map[] = {
+ { PAD_CFG0_RESET_PWROK, PAD_CFG0_RESET_PWROK },
+ { PAD_CFG0_RESET_DEEP, PAD_CFG0_RESET_DEEP },
+ { PAD_CFG0_RESET_PLTRST, PAD_CFG0_RESET_PLTRST },
+};
+
+static const struct pad_community apl_gpio_communities[] = {
+ {
+ .port = PID_GPIO_SW,
+ .first_pad = SW_OFFSET,
+ .last_pad = LPC_FRAMEB,
+ .num_gpi_regs = NUM_SW_GPI_REGS,
+ .gpi_status_offset = 0,
+ .pad_cfg_base = PAD_CFG_BASE,
+ .host_own_reg_0 = HOSTSW_OWN_REG_0,
+ .gpi_smi_sts_reg_0 = GPI_SMI_STS_0,
+ .gpi_smi_en_reg_0 = GPI_SMI_EN_0,
+ .max_pads_per_group = GPIO_MAX_NUM_PER_GROUP,
+ .name = "GPIO_GPE_SW",
+ .acpi_path = "\\_SB.GPO3",
+ .reset_map = rst_map,
+ .num_reset_vals = ARRAY_SIZE(rst_map),
+ }, {
+ .port = PID_GPIO_W,
+ .first_pad = W_OFFSET,
+ .last_pad = SUSPWRDNACK,
+ .num_gpi_regs = NUM_W_GPI_REGS,
+ .gpi_status_offset = NUM_SW_GPI_REGS,
+ .pad_cfg_base = PAD_CFG_BASE,
+ .host_own_reg_0 = HOSTSW_OWN_REG_0,
+ .gpi_smi_sts_reg_0 = GPI_SMI_STS_0,
+ .gpi_smi_en_reg_0 = GPI_SMI_EN_0,
+ .max_pads_per_group = GPIO_MAX_NUM_PER_GROUP,
+ .name = "GPIO_GPE_W",
+ .acpi_path = "\\_SB.GPO2",
+ .reset_map = rst_map,
+ .num_reset_vals = ARRAY_SIZE(rst_map),
+ }, {
+ .port = PID_GPIO_NW,
+ .first_pad = NW_OFFSET,
+ .last_pad = GPIO_123,
+ .num_gpi_regs = NUM_NW_GPI_REGS,
+ .gpi_status_offset = NUM_W_GPI_REGS + NUM_SW_GPI_REGS,
+ .pad_cfg_base = PAD_CFG_BASE,
+ .host_own_reg_0 = HOSTSW_OWN_REG_0,
+ .gpi_smi_sts_reg_0 = GPI_SMI_STS_0,
+ .gpi_smi_en_reg_0 = GPI_SMI_EN_0,
+ .max_pads_per_group = GPIO_MAX_NUM_PER_GROUP,
+ .name = "GPIO_GPE_NW",
+ .acpi_path = "\\_SB.GPO1",
+ .reset_map = rst_map,
+ .num_reset_vals = ARRAY_SIZE(rst_map),
+ }, {
+ .port = PID_GPIO_N,
+ .first_pad = N_OFFSET,
+ .last_pad = SVID0_CLK,
+ .num_gpi_regs = NUM_N_GPI_REGS,
+ .gpi_status_offset = NUM_NW_GPI_REGS + NUM_W_GPI_REGS
+ + NUM_SW_GPI_REGS,
+ .pad_cfg_base = PAD_CFG_BASE,
+ .host_own_reg_0 = HOSTSW_OWN_REG_0,
+ .gpi_smi_sts_reg_0 = GPI_SMI_STS_0,
+ .gpi_smi_en_reg_0 = GPI_SMI_EN_0,
+ .max_pads_per_group = GPIO_MAX_NUM_PER_GROUP,
+ .name = "GPIO_GPE_N",
+ .acpi_path = "\\_SB.GPO0",
+ .reset_map = rst_map,
+ .num_reset_vals = ARRAY_SIZE(rst_map),
+ }
+};
+
+const struct pad_community *soc_gpio_get_community(size_t *num_communities)
+{
+ *num_communities = ARRAY_SIZE(apl_gpio_communities);
+ return apl_gpio_communities;
+}
+
+const struct pmc_to_gpio_route *soc_pmc_gpio_routes(size_t *num)
+{
+ static const struct pmc_to_gpio_route routes[] = {
+ { PMC_GPE_SW_31_0, GPIO_GPE_SW_31_0 },
+ { PMC_GPE_SW_63_32, GPIO_GPE_SW_63_32 },
+ { PMC_GPE_NW_31_0, GPIO_GPE_NW_31_0 },
+ { PMC_GPE_NW_63_32, GPIO_GPE_NW_63_32 },
+ { PMC_GPE_NW_95_64, GPIO_GPE_NW_95_64 },
+ { PMC_GPE_N_31_0, GPIO_GPE_N_31_0 },
+ { PMC_GPE_N_63_32, GPIO_GPE_N_63_32 },
+ { PMC_GPE_W_31_0, GPIO_GPE_W_31_0 },
+ };
+ *num = ARRAY_SIZE(routes);
+ return routes;
+}
